Gyudon Japanese Beef Bowl

This is basically a common Japanese fast food where beef and caramelized onions are served on top of short-grain rice. Perfect when hot, cold, or room temperature. Good for school lunches on hot days.

πŸ‘¨β€πŸ³ Instructions

Halve the onion and discard the central-most part.

Cut halves into thin slices.

Heat oil in a large skillet or wok over high heat.

Add onion; cook and stir until it starts to brown, about 30 seconds.

Reduce heat to medium-low; add water, soy sauce, brown sugar, mirin, and sake and simmer until flavors combine, about 3 minutes.

Stir beef into the skillet.

Cook, covered, until beef is cooked through, 3 to 5 minutes.

Divide between serving bowls and garnish with sesame seeds, green onions, ginger, and seaweed strips.
